China’s Lisuan Tech pitches LX 7G100 as an RTX 4060 rival, but tests show RTX 3060-level performance at $485
Lisuan Tech has launched its homegrown LX 7G100 graphics card, marketing it as competitive with Nvidia’s RTX 4060, but benchmark results put it closer to an RTX 3060. In game tests, its frame rates trailed even older GPUs, including the AMD Radeon RX 6600 XT, and the card lacks ray tracing, according to BiliBili reviewer 潮玩客. Despite that, Lisuan Tech is pricing the LX 7G100 at $485, above newer alternatives in a similar range such as the RTX 5060 and RX 9060 XT. The gap underscores the difficulty of matching Nvidia-class performance and ecosystem support.

China’s Xpeng moves toward large-scale robotaxi production in 2026, challenging Tesla’s Cybercab push
Xpeng plans to start large-scale production of driverless robotaxis in March 2026 and aims to roll them out more broadly within the year. Its robotaxi service is already operating in multiple locations in China, and the company is also pursuing an international expansion. The pace adds competitive pressure to Tesla’s Cybercab timeline and its technology-lead narrative, particularly around valuation benchmarks in smart mobility across China, the U.S., and global markets.

Mysk says Apple logs every tap and search in the App Store for recommendations
Security researchers at Mysk say Apple is recording every tap users make in the App Store, including typing speed, search terms and touch locations, to power personalized recommendations. They say users have no option to disable the tracking, raising questions about how the practice squares with Apple’s long-running “privacy is a fundamental human right” messaging. The feature is currently limited to U.S. users in English but is expected to expand to more regions.
